Local Weather Risks in Vanlue

πŸŒͺ️

Triggers

High winds (especially above 50 mph), large hail, heavy rain bands, ice storms, and rapid snowmelt. Straight-line winds common in northwest Ohio can peel shingles and damage flashing without warning.

πŸ“…

Seasonal Risks

Roofing emergencies in Vanlue are most common during spring and summer thunderstorm season (April–August) and winter freeze-thaw cycles (December–February). Fall can bring wind damage from early-season storms. Call volumes typically spike immediately after severe weather passes through Hancock County.

🏚️

Disaster Scenarios

Post-storm scenarios include wind-scoured shingle fields, puncture damage from hail, and water intrusion at flashing points. Freeze-thaw cycles create ice dams that force water under shingles. Heavy snow loads (exceeding 20 lbs/sq ft) can stress older roof structures. Power outages following storms can delay detection of active leaks.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• βœ“ Inspect your roof and attic after every major storm β€” look for wet insulation, dark ceiling spots, or daylight coming through the roof deck.
  • βœ“ Keep gutters and downspouts clear year-round, especially before winter freeze and spring rain seasons.
  • βœ“ Trim overhanging tree limbs that could fall on your roof during high winds or ice storms.
  • βœ“ Know the age of your roof β€” asphalt shingles over 15–20 years old are more vulnerable to storm damage and sudden failure.
  • βœ“ Document any pre-existing damage with photos and notes before storm season to help with insurance claims if an emergency occurs.

❓ What should I do while waiting for help?

Contain the leak β€” place buckets under drips and move valuables, electronics, and furniture to dry areas. If safe, cover small holes with a tarp from the inside. Do not go on the roof in wet or icy conditions. Turn off power to affected rooms if water is near electrical outlets or fixtures.

❓ Will insurance cover emergency roof repairs?

Many homeowner and commercial property policies cover sudden damage from storms, wind, hail, and fallen tree limbs. Emergency tarping and temporary repairs are often covered. Contact your insurance provider promptly and document all damage with photos before any work begins.
